RSA_sign, RSA_verify - RSA signatures

SSSSYYYYNNNNOOOOPPPPSSSSIIIISSSS

#include

int RSA_sign(int type, const unsigned char *m, unsigned int m_len,

unsigned char *sigret, unsigned int *siglen, RSA *rsa);

int RSA_verify(int type, const unsigned char *m, unsigned int m_len,

unsigned char *sigbuf, unsigned int siglen, RSA *rsa); DDDDEEEESSSSCCCCRRRRIIIIPPPPTTTTIIIIOOOONNNN

RSA_sign() signs the message digest mmmm of size mmmm_lllleeeennnn using

the private key rrrrssssaaaa as specified in PKCS #1 v2.0. It stores

the signature in ssssiiiiggggrrrreeeetttt and the signature size in ssssiiiigggglllleeeennnn.

ssssiiiiggggrrrreeeetttt must point to RSA_size(rrrrssssaaaa) bytes of memory.

ttttyyyyppppeeee denotes the message digest algorithm that was used to

generate mmmm. It usually is one of NNNNIIIIDDDD_sssshhhhaaaa1111, NNNNIIIIDDDD_rrrriiiippppeeeemmmmdddd111166660000 and

NNNNIIIIDDDD_mmmmdddd5555; see objects(3) for details. If ttttyyyyppppeeee is

NNNNIIIIDDDD_mmmmdddd5555_sssshhhhaaaa1111, an SSL signature (MD5 and SHA1 message digests

with PKCS #1 padding and no algorithm identifier) is

created.

RSA_verify() verifies that the signature ssssiiiiggggbbbbuuuuffff of size

ssssiiiigggglllleeeennnn matches a given message digest mmmm of size mmmm_lllleeeennnn. ttttyyyyppppeeee

denotes the message digest algorithm that was used to generate the signature. rrrrssssaaaa is the signer's public key. RRRREEEETTTTUUUURRRRNNNN VVVVAAAALLLLUUUUEEEESSSS

RSA_sign() returns 1 on success, 0 otherwise. RSA_verify()

returns 1 on successful verification, 0 otherwise.

The error codes can be obtained by ERR_get_error(3).

RSA_sign() and RSA_verify() are available in all versions of

SSLeay and OpenSSL.
